BREAKING: Rangers Win NPFL Title
Rangers International Football Club of Enugu have officially been crowned champions of the 2025/2026 Nigeria Premier Football League (NPFL) following a hard-fought 2-1 victory over Ikorodu City at the Mobolaji Johnson Arena in Lagos. �
The crucial win secured the Flying Antelopes’ second league title in three years under coach Fidelis Ilechukwu and further strengthened the club’s place among Nigeria’s most successful football teams. �
Team captain Chidiebere N’Obodo emerged as the hero of the night after scoring both goals for Rangers. He opened scoring in the 30th minute before adding a second goal in the 55th minute. Ikorodu City later pulled one back through Moses Ali, but Rangers held firm to secure the victory and the championship. �
Heading into the final matchday, Rangers were leading the NPFL table with 65 points, narrowly ahead of Rivers United who had 64 points. The victory ensured Rangers finished top regardless of results elsewhere. �
